Most failures surveyed for electric motors are influenced by the particular industry, the geographic location and combination of applications in use. Rotating machine plays a vital role in industrial applications. Due to its variety of applications, it is difficult to diagnose the very cause of failure. Heavy duty rotating equipment are more prone to have failure with catastrophic consequences, if not rectified.Most failures surveyed for electric motors are influenced by the particular industry, the geographic location and combination of applications in use.
